Transaction 3b5b504a39a04c63293239927e81d52404ba4037540dc5fecb2f11cc1302882d
1 Input
1 Output
-
3b5b504a39a04c63293239927e81d52404ba4037540dc5fecb2f11cc1302882d:0
- value
- 149049
- script pubkey
- OP_0 OP_PUSHBYTES_20 18d7e1e490a8791f674879da22d3e9b8eeb6a250
- address
- bc1qrrt7reys4pu37e6g08dz95lfhrhtdgjsx0j46c